Published by Emerging Threats Open ↗, licensed under BSD 3-Clause ↗. Line breaks added for readability; the rule is otherwise unchanged.
alert http $EXTERNAL_NET any -> $HTTP_SERVERS any (
    msg:"ET SCAN Httprecon Web Server Fingerprint Scan";
    flow:to_server,established;
    http.method;
    content:"GET";
    http.uri;
    content:"/etc/passwd?format=";
    content:"><script>alert('xss')";
    content:"traversal=";
    reference:url,www.computec.ch/projekte/httprecon/;
    classtype:attempted-recon;
    sid:2008627; rev:11;
    metadata:created_at 2010_07_30, confidence Medium, signature_severity Informational, updated_at 2020_09_14;
)
